Were looking for a Learning Experience Partner to join our Nottingham-based Operational Learning & Development team.
This is a hybrid role with an expectation of 40% of your week on site. We are looking for flexibility to increase onsite attendance to deliver face to face learning and meet operational demands. The vendor partner team may also require occasional offshore travel to support them.
You will report into the L&D Manager and be a core part of the evolution of our learning model. We are moving away from traditional separations between learning design and delivery and promoting end-to-end ownership. The Learning Experience Partner creates seamless and high impact learning experiences by managing the learner journey from design through delivery and continuous improvement.
- You will lead the full learning lifecycle from design and development through to delivery evaluation and iteration.
- Ensure agreement between learning intent and delivery creating a consistent learner experience.
- Apply instructional design principles alongside facilitation to deliver high quality engaging learning.
- Use real-time delivery insight and learner feedback to refine content quickly eliminating delays caused by traditional handovers.
- Work with partners to develop learning solutions that meet operational needs while maintaining pace and quality.
- Partner with the Zingtree Development Team to ensure learning processes and knowledge tools are aligned creating a seamless experience for learners in live operations.
- Support flexible and scalable learning delivery adapting approaches to changing priorities and demand.
- Demonstrate collaboration and communication contributing positively to a shared team culture.
Qualifications :
- Demonstrable capability in either instructional design or learning delivery with a clear understanding of both disciplines and a willingness to develop capability across the full learning lifecycle.
- The ability to develop learning content in an agile way and iterating solutions based on learner feedback and performance insight.
- A strong learner centric mindset with the ability to simplify complex information into clear engaging learning experiences.
- High digital confidence with a interest in modern learning technologies and data informed learning approaches.
- Learner focused proactive and committed to continuous improvement.
- You will balance speed and quality while maintaining high learning standards.
- Digitally fluent and motivated to evolve how learning is designed delivered and improved.
- Accountable for learning outcomes not just activity.
